Why Crypto Events Matter
The significance of crypto events extends beyond mere attendance. They are catalysts for progress, fostering collaboration and discovery.
- Networking Opportunities: Connect with like-minded individuals, investors, partners, and industry leaders. Face-to-face interactions often lead to stronger connections.
- Education and Insights: Gain knowledge from experts on latest tech advancements, regulatory changes, market trends, and investment strategies. Deep dives demystify the landscape.
- Project Showcases and Launches: Discover new blockchain projects, DApps, NFTs, and protocols. Offers early access to innovations and direct interaction with project teams.
- Investment and Partnership Potential: Meet VCs, angel investors, and accelerators seeking promising projects. Startups can secure vital funding and alliances.
- Community Building: Foster a strong sense of community, uniting individuals passionate about decentralization. This collective energy drives adoption and solves challenges.
Types of Crypto Events
The crypto event landscape is diverse, catering to various interests and expertise levels.
- Major Conferences & Summits: Global behemoths like Consensus, Token2049, and EthDenver attract thousands, featuring multiple stages, renowned speakers, and exhibition floors. They cover broad topics.
- Developer Meetups & Hackathons: Highly technical, focusing on coding, protocol development, and solving real-world challenges with blockchain. Often lead to innovative prototypes.
- Online Webinars & AMAs: Accessible globally, these digital events offer focused discussions on specific topics, project updates, or direct Q&A with founders.
- Local Meetups & Workshops: Community-driven, providing a relaxed setting for networking, learning basic skills, and discussing regional crypto trends.
- NFT Art Galleries & Experiences: Celebrating digital art, collectibles, and the metaverse, combining physical displays with virtual reality experiences.

Navigating the Crypto Event Landscape
To maximize your event experience:
- Research & Planning: Identify events aligned with your goals (learning, networking, investment). Review agendas and speaker lists in advance.
- Maximizing Your Experience: Prepare an elevator pitch, engage actively in Q&A, and follow up promptly. Don’t just listen; participate.
- Virtual vs. In-Person: In-person offers richer networking but higher costs. Virtual provides accessibility and convenience but may lack interaction depth.
